Herman A.W. Hazewinkel is a scholar working on Small Animals,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Herman A.W. Hazewinkel has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Small Animals, 11 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ine and 9 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Herman A.W. Hazewinkel’s work include Veterinary Orthopedics and Neurology (24 papers), Spine and Intervertebral Disc Pathology (9 papers) and Veterinary Equine Medical Research (8 papers). Herman A.W. Hazewinkel is often cited by papers focused on Veterinary Orthopedics and Neurology (24 papers), Spine and Intervertebral Disc Pathology (9 papers) and Veterinary Equine Medical Research (8 papers). Herman A.W. Hazewinkel coll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ands, Sweden and Thailand. Herman A.W. Hazewinkel's co-authors include Björn P. Meij, George Voorhout, Guy C. M. Grinwis, Niklas Bergknut, Marianna A. Tryfonidou, Lucas A. Smolders, Anne‐Sofie Lagerstedt, Ragnvi Hagman, Lars F.H. Theyse and Niyada Suwankong and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, PLoS ONE and Journal of Nutrition.
